The sand looks awefully soft. What pressure were your tires at?

tower 06-03-2005 04:14 AM

Roxie, I dropped 'em down to 18 psi. Obviously I could have gone a lot lower and I'm sure my floatation would have improved. But I was concerned about 2 issues.

Stories abound generally, regarding getting sand caught between bead and rim and thereby sustaining slow leaks on the tires. This especially fine, light sand got into EVERYTHING. I needed to detail when I got home. Going to a tire shop to have all 4 tires pulled, cleaned and remounted isn't that big a deal, but since I was only wheeling for a day or two, it seemed excessive.

Also, powersliding (hitting the gas to spin the tires while sliding laterally) is common in sand. If your pressure is really low, pop goes the bead off the rim! I don't know what pressure Jeff B was running when he did his triple roll in the bowl, but all 4 tires came off their rims.

If I had beadlockers I probably would have dropped to 12 or 10psi; certainly not below 6 or 5.
